Canada is a country full of diverse people known for their strong independence and remarkable politeness. Statistics indicate that a significant portion of Canada’s population is single. Recently, single-person households became the most common household type in Canada. In fact, 29.36% of Canadian households were single-person households in 2021. FAQs: What Is the Most Successful Dating Site From Canada?

This answer may surprise you, but Ashley Madison is the most popular dating site that started in Canada and became a worldwide phenomenon. Ashley Madison gained its success by helping countless users find a discreet and fun connection. Now, Canadian singles can engage in secretive, spicy conversations with people from across the ocean.

Cellphone with Ashley Madison logo in front of laptop with Ashley Madison website on screen
Based in Canada, Ashley Madison has over 80 million users worldwide.

Another big name in the online dating industry that has its roots in Canada: Plenty of Fish. The free dating site launched in 2003 and started in Canada before going global.
